The 14 Best Portland Restaurants and Bars With Mocktails and Nonalcoholic Drinks | Eater Portland

"Known for inventive Thai food and maximalist cocktails, the drinks on Eem’s “clear headed” menu also use fun ingredients from the kitchen in affordable spirit-free cocktails that are $7 each. A housemade cucumber yuzu shrub and ginger lime soda make up the refreshing and simple Approved by Chef, which is perfect for pairing with spicy food. If you’re looking for a more complicated zero-proof drink, try the That’s It, That’s All, with coconut cream, pineapple soda, lime, cinnamon, and grapefruit." - Thom Hilton
